4. Descript β Best for Video and Audio Editing
Descript simplifies video and audio editing.
What makes it powerful:
- edit video like text
- remove filler words
How creators use it:
- podcasts
- YouTube videos
Real impact:
π Faster editing workflow.

Content Creator Hack: Create 3x More Content Without Burnout
Most creators try to do everything from scratch.
Thatβs the mistake.
Instead, repurpose your content using AI.
Example:
- 1 video β 3 short clips
- 1 article β 5 social posts
- 1 idea β multiple formats
π This multiplies your output.
